2001 Expedition flying land barge

2001 Ford Expedition EB 4x4 AWD HI/LO Automatic Transmission

150k miles

Engine: 5.4 SOHC
Vortech J trim centrifugal supercharger charge cooled aka, inter-cooled after cooled
Snow Water/methanol injection system.

Exhaust system: short tube headers, 3in to 3.5 with a magna flow muffler. It's loud as hell when in the throttle but nice and smooth when driven normal.

Fuel system: 42lbs Fuel injectors, 255lph walboro fuel pump

Cooling system: flex-a-lite E fans,180 t stat, hi flow mechanical water pump. This sucker runs cool even in summer!!

Transmission: 4r100 was rebuilt 4 years ago with a full race rebuild. 3000 Stall torque converter "WILL NEED A NEW TORQUE CONVERTER SOON" about $700 installed at shops give or take.

All professionally tuned ECM by local kick *** speed shop IVMotorsports in sparks.

Ice cold AC, fire ***** from hell heater. Front and rear heat/ac automatic Climate control.

7in DVD double din with GPS and hand free. Rear ps2 and over head screen.

3ed row seat, tires are 90% remaining bought 1.5 years ago.

Leather is in great shape with some wear and tear, heated front seats. Paint is great with no major scratches or dents. MTX sub and speakers. It thumps but its not a gheto blaster.

Over all a nice tow pig for its age! She's a ripper pushing 14-16 psi Never on the qt. mile but easily deep 12's ET!!! That's flying for a land barge.

It easily takes out mildly modified 4.6 3 valve mustangs and murders the 2 valve mustangs all stinking day long!! Old fox body stangs aren't even worth screwing with.

FUEL MILLAGE is far better then a stock 5.4 expedition so as long as you keep your foot out of the boost. I can see as high as 18mpg at 70mph with little head wind. NO BS!! You step on it and you get the point.

Must run no lower then 89 octane but 91 is best. The meth injection helps a ton with varying fuel quality.
